music festival , the latest of which took place atCharleville Castle (described as being situated in Ireland's most ancient primordial oak woods) inTullamore ,County Offaly over the2007 August Bank Holiday weekend (4 and 5). The 2006 festival was described by "Hot Press" as a "bite-sizedElectric Picnic , held in the grounds of a 17th-century castle, with the added bonus of indoor toilets and showers". Ticket holders (of which there are 1500) have exclusive access to the castle all day over the weekend withart exhibition s, a fortune teller, masseuse, games, acocktail bar,comedy club andburlesque shows on view alongside the music. Some of the proceeds from each ticket go towards the ongoing Charleville Castle Restoration Project.According to "Hot Press", the 2008 edition will be held from

The 2006 festival was held on the weekend of
July 30 and was headlined byThe Chapters ,Saucy Monky , 8 Ball and [The Blizzards] , withpenfold dm on the Saturday, whilstRepublic of Loose andDelorentos took to the stage on Sunday withThe Spikes beginning in an early morning slot. Also playing wereThe Gorgeous Colours ,The Chakras andNeosupervital .2007 festival
The 2007 festival was headlined by
Sister Sledge ,Noise Control , Mainline,The Chapters andNeosupervital . It took place alongside the freeIndie-pendence festival which is set to occur inMitchelstown ,County Cork on the same weekend. Castle Palooza, however, had full camping facilities and tickets were priced at €125, as well as the handsomest "cocktail" barmen in the occidental hemisphere. The 2008 festival took place over the
August 2 -3 Bank Holiday weekend. A number of international bands were booked, includingSouth Africa n bandThe Parlotones and the UK'sMystery Jets . They played the tiny event alongside Irish acts such asRepublic of Loose ,Fight Like Apes andThe Flaws . The Castle Palooza capacity remained at 2000 and the flushing toilets and hot showers returned. The festival also added a charitable aspect with profits going towards the ongoing restoration project at Charleville Castle, which has been in progress for 12 years.
